Domo Genesis & The Alchemist - No Idols
Domo understood the assignment!! The Alchemist is probably one of the best producers alive.
This mixtape is so underrated the samples are crazy and get Domo into this more aggressive flow. The feature list is rare: Tyler, Earl, Vince Staples, Action Bronson, Smoke DZA, Freddie Gibbs & Spaceghostpurrp, all delivered. It’s different than the usual OF sound but aged well and could might as well be a new album. Really really like it and would recommend any rap fan to check it out regardless of being an OF fan.
Fav songs: Prophecy, All Alone, Power Ballad, Till The Angels Come, No Idols.

MellowHype - Numbers
Sadly pretty weak for MellowHype, apart for a few highlights this album leans more into the mainstream sound of those years, like somebody like Wayne or Big Sean could go over these songs, and this used to be a pretty dark grim sound for OF with just a little bit of “swag”. Makes you appreciate the style of the earlier projects a bit more and it sucks that in a year where a lot of members showed development, while this sounds more defined it’s forgettable.
Fav songs: Grill, 65 / Breakfast, P2, Break.
